Transaction 176134d95f33634c5c36f084b01c99fd8626ab701506e15dc016adcedaa09218
1 Input
1 Output
-
176134d95f33634c5c36f084b01c99fd8626ab701506e15dc016adcedaa09218:0
- value
- 61779
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 da0abbba8ddd2bb842cf22c53d8f0e8dab14b6c8a5d898a04a8cd5949d2e24f1
- address
- bc1pmg9thw5dm54mssk0ytznmrcw3k43fdkg5hvf3gz23n2ef8fwyncs0rahqs